[OPPAZ] Organic Producers’ and Processors’ Association of Zambia is a non-profit making organization which implements Sustainable Socio-Economic and Ecological Design in which it provides Technical, Training and Extension, Production and Marketing Services to members throughout the country while pursuing a robust lobby and advocacy for pro-organic reforms. It targets 20,000 poor but economically viable direct beneficiary HHs with an expected extended outreach to 120,000 organic producers for support to produce, add value and annually market K780 million worth of certified natural and organic products by the year 2030. The chief objective is to develop sustainable livelihoods based on crops, livestock and non-timber forest products.

OPPAZ has embarked on OFS RFZ [Organic Food Systems: Impacts of a strong Organic Program on the Right to Food for individuals, households and communities in Zambia] which is derived from SSEED and funded by We Effect with a chief objective to strengthen the operational and governance capacity of the organic movement in Zambia for the latter to deliver equable organic agriculture value chain services and technologies for improvement of livelihoods of disadvantaged persons in Zambia. The Project is implemented in Chongwe, Kaputa, Lunte/Luwingu, Mpongwe and Petauke/Sinda districts.
